Shannon Estuary 26th june

Fri Jun 26, 2009 8:21 pm

People:Me, Jim and Andy from Dover SAC

Duration:6hours

Tide:low 14.21

Weather:Everything exept snow

Bait:Fresh mackerel, squid sandeel

Rigs:pulleys

Results: 1 dog 1 flounder 2 thornbacks
12lb 4oz stingray




Report:

I have been doing a few sessions with the Dover lads since they arrived on Monday. Up to today we have managed to land 15 rays and countless dogs in two sessions.

When I arrived at the mark the lads were already fishing. It didnt take me long to get two baits in the water, but unlike the previous days things were very quiet. Andy opened up the score with a dog and then Jim with a thornie of about 5lbs. I was getting no end of abuse for not being able to catch on home ground!!

A slack line bite signaled a ray to me and I was thankful for the bite to shut the two lads up. When I struck I thought I was snagged but as I worked the rig loose it shot of uptide, I hadnt a clue what I had hooked but it was taking line,then it turned and came directly towards me, I thought it was a big bass. I was delighted when I managed to beach it. It was my first stingray and my first double figure ray in Ireland.

I had a few handling problems with it as it was the angryest fish I have ever landed and its tail and sting thrashed about like it was possesed. After weighing and a few photos (none of me holding it) we managed to get it retuned where it rested for about 10 minutes before making its way back to the depths of the Shannon.

youngrod wrote:class wat bait did it take and wat weight line were you using for the trace



Fresh mackerel mounted on a pennel pulley rig. 5/0 varivas big mouth hooks. 80lb sakuma rig body and hook length. 18lb red ice mainline. 5oz impact grip lead

I use 70/80 lb hooklength for all my traces so it can put up with Bullhuss tearing at it.
